What’s the Deal with the Deployment Server?

So, let’s lay it out clearly: the primary role of a Deployment Server in Splunk is to deploy apps and configurations to multiple instances. That’s the key takeaway here. Unlike mundane tasks like managing user permissions or analyzing logs, the Deployment Server steps in to ensure all your Splunk instances—think forwarders and indexers—are harmoniously synced up with the right applications and configurations.

The Centralization Magic

Centralizing the deployment of apps means you can manage your Splunk environment much more efficiently. It allows you to push updates and configurations at the click of a button. Want to roll out a new app? Or perhaps update existing configurations? With a Deployment Server, you can do it all without trekking through numerous instances. It’s like being the conductor of an orchestra. Instead of each musician trying to play their tune independently, you lead them to create a beautiful symphony.

Now, if we delve into technical territory for a moment, you’ll discover that the Deployment Server uses what’s called a “deployment client.” This component acts as a liaison between your Splunk instances and the Deployment Server itself. Each Splunk instance informs the Deployment Server about its needs—like the apps it requires and the configurations it’s running. The Deployment Server listens to these calls for help and responds accordingly, making sure everyone’s in sync.

The Importance of Consistency

Another fantastic benefit of using a Deployment Server lies in maintaining consistency across your entire Splunk setup. Imagine this scenario: you roll out a new app without coordinating through the Deployment Server. Some instances get the update, while others don’t. Suddenly, you’re working with a patchwork quilt of configurations that can lead to serious headaches during troubleshooting or analysis. That just creates a recipe for chaos!

The Deployment Server ensures everyone is on the same page, which, in turn, reduces administrative overhead. When using an efficient orchestration model, your team can focus more on what truly matters—pushing your analytics capabilities to the next level.
